导入到xls文件时,将删除加号

时间:2018-02-20 08:42:39

标签: laravel laravel-5 phpexcel

Laravel版本5.4

预期的行为 enter image description here

实际行为 enter image description here 重现行为的步骤

Alter Table `mytable`  
  PARTITION BY RANGE (TO_DAYS(`TimeStart`)) 
(
    PARTITION start                 VALUES LESS THAN (0),
    PARTITION from".$curdate."      VALUES LESS THAN TO_DAYS(".$nextdateTime."),
    PARTITION future                VALUES LESS THAN MAXVALUE
);

如何使用加号导入数字?

2 个答案:

答案 0 :(得分:2)

如果是微软excel,或类似的应用程序;然后它不在你的代码中,excel将+数字视为正数,因此它删除了+,也用零发生,尝试包括'''包装你的值以将其转换为字符串并防止excel这样做。

答案 1 :(得分:0)

这是因为你期望的数字是一个正数(+49983),如果用+号重现数字,它会在excel中显示时删除+符号。

要检查打开一个新的Excel并尝试添加+49983并移至下一列,+将自动消失,因为正数。